Close to quarter of a million dollars in prize money is up for grabs in Government’s Modern School Infrastructure Design Competition.
The initiative was announced today during a ceremony attended by Senior Minister Dr. William Duguid, Education Minister Kay McConney and other officials.
There are four categories for the designs, Nursery, Primary, Secondary and Special Needs and the top 3 in each category will be awarded.
Dr. Duguid says the competition is open to all registered architects.
Minister McConney outlined the expectations for the designs, while Chief Education Officer, Dr. Ramona Archer-Bradshaw shared her view on what schools of the future should encompass.
